Role Summary:
Join our Early Talent Recruitment team in a key role within Experience and Assessment, helping to create an outstanding candidate journey from application through to start date. As Assessment Experience Co-ordinator, you will bring our Graduate, Internship and Apprentice interviews to life—co-ordinating every detail of first- and final-stage interviews, warmly welcoming candidates, guiding them through their schedules, and ensuring assessors and guest speakers have everything they need for each session to run seamlessly.
Key Responsibilities:
Recruitment Coordinator Responsibilities
• Scheduling and coordinating first and final-stage interviews, managing all logistics to ensure a seamless experience for candidates and interviewers.
• Managing interview scheduling platforms and tools, including sending invitations, confirmations, and joining instructions to all parties.
• Serving as the primary point of contact for candidate queries throughout the interview process, providing timely and professional support.
• Developing and preparing all interviewer briefing materials, candidate guides, and interview packs ahead of each session.
• Co-ordinating interviewers and panel members, keeping to strict timelines and ensuring all participants have the information they need.
• Collating interview outcomes and feedback and sharing results with the relevant recruitment and hiring teams.
• Maintaining database accuracy, ensuring 100% accuracy of candidate records, scheduling data, and reporting throughout the interview process.
• Managing and triaging the recruitment inbox, responding promptly to candidate and interviewer queries and processing any schedule adjustments or reasonable adjustments.
• Rescheduling interviews as required and proactively managing interviewer availability to minimise disruption to the recruitment timeline.
